Our History & Journey
Our Story
Ethiopian Evangelical Church of Denver
EECD began in 1986, when a small number of Ethiopian immigrants started gathering as a fellowship. In its early days the church found its home on South University Boulevard in Aurora, a small space that became a sanctuary of unity for people from diverse backgrounds. As the congregation grew, the church moved to University Hills Baptist Church on South Yale Avenue in Denver from 1998 to 2000, then to a middle school at 13th and Chambers in Aurora from 2000 to 2001, a season that reflected the church's adaptability and resilience. Today EECD worships at 445 S. Lansing Street in Aurora, serving adults, youth, and children of Ethiopian, Eritrean, and American heritage. Through every location, the story has been the same: perseverance, diversity, and spiritual growth, a community woven together by devotion to Christ.

What We Believe
We believe in the Holy Trinity, the divinity of Jesus Christ, the authority of Scripture, and salvation through faith alone.
Core Values
What We Stand For
Biblical Authority
The belief that the Bible is the inspired Word of God and the ultimate authority for all matters of faith and practice.
Family
We believe family is created by God and a healthy family is the basis of a strong and functional church.
Unity
The commitment to work together in harmony and unity, recognizing that we are all members of one body in Christ.
Service
We value serving others with humility, compassion, and a desire for servanthood.
